Theater building
The , also known as the Théâtre de Versailles, is a French theatre in rue des Réservoirs, Versailles, near the . It was created by the actress and theatre director Mademoiselle Montansier, designed by Jean-François Heurtier, inspecteur général des bâtiments du roi and designer of the first Salle Favart of the . is situated 740 metres south of Maison des pommiers.

Locality
The is a rustic retreat in the park of the Château de Versailles built for Marie Antoinette in 1783 near the in , France.
